当前位置: 首页 > news >正文

gta5显示网站建设中wordpress网站加密码

gta5显示网站建设中,wordpress网站加密码,中国电商,wordpress插件汉化Java是世界上使用最广泛的语言#xff08;需要引用#xff09;#xff0c;每个人对此都有自己的见解。 由于它是主流#xff0c;所以通常会嘲笑它#xff0c;有时是正确的#xff0c;但有时批评只是不切合实际。 我将尝试解释我最喜欢的5个关于Java的误解。 Java速度很慢… Java是世界上使用最广泛的语言需要引用每个人对此都有自己的见解。 由于它是主流所以通常会嘲笑它有时是正确的但有时批评只是不切合实际。 我将尝试解释我最喜欢的5个关于Java的误解。 Java速度很慢 – Java 1.0可能确实如此并且最初听起来似乎合乎逻辑因为Java不是编译成二进制而是编译成字节码而字节码又被解释了。 但是现代版本的JVM进行了非常非常优化JVM优化不仅是一篇文章而且是一整本书的主题而且不再是遥不可及的了。 如此处所述 在某些情况下 Java甚至可以与C 媲美。 如果您是Ruby或PHP开发人员那么开个关于Java变慢的笑话当然不是一个好主意。 Java太冗长 -在这里我们需要将语言从SDK和其他库中分离出来。 JDK例如java.io中有一些冗长的细节这是1.用事实上的标准库例如guava轻松克服了2. 一件好事 至于语言的冗长性唯一合理的一点是匿名类。 在Java 8中这些功能不再是问题。 Getters和setters Foo foo new Foo()而不是使用val 可能是样板但它并不冗长-不会在代码上增加概念上的分量。 不需要花费更多的时间来编写阅读或理解。 其他库–看到像AbstractCommonAsyncFacadeFactoryManagerImpl这样的类确实很吓人。 但这与Java无关。 可以说有时这些长名称是有意义的也可以说它们是如此复杂因为底层的抽象不必要地复杂但是无论哪种方式这都是每个库做出的设计决定而语言或语言都不是什么。 SDK会强制执行。 看到过度设计的东西是很常见的但是Java绝不会将您推向这个方向-可以使用任何语言以简单的方式完成东西。 您肯定可以在Ruby中使用AbstractCommonAsyncFacadeFactoryManagerImpl 只是没有一个愚蠢的建筑师认为这是个好主意并且使用Ruby。 如果“大型认真沉重”的公司都在使用Ruby我敢打赌我们会看到相同的情况。 企业Java框架是过时的软件 –肯定在2002年使用EJB 2时或者“已经”我还太年轻无法记住确实如此。 而且您仍然确实不需要一些过度设计和过时的应用程序服务器。 人们使用它们的事实是他们自己的问题。 您可以使用SpringGuice甚至CDI之类的框架来拥有一个完美易读易于配置和部署的Web应用程序。 使用诸如Spring-MVCPlayWicket甚至最新的JSF之类的Web框架。 甚至没有任何框架如果您不想重复使用通过真实世界使用的框架。 您可以拥有一个使用消息队列NoSQL和SQL数据库Amazon S3文件存储等的应用程序而不会造成任何意外的复杂性。 的确人们仍然喜欢吃惊的东西并在不需要的地方添加几层但是框架为您提供这种功能的事实并不意味着他们会让您做到这一点。 例如 这是一个应用程序 可对政府文档进行爬网为其编制索引并提供用于搜索和订阅的UI。 听起来有点简单确实如此。 它是用Scala非常用Java的方式编写的但仅使用Java框架-springspring-mvclucenejacksonguava。 我想您可以开始快速维护因为它很简单。 您不能使用Java快速原型设计 -这与上一点有关-假定使用Java的速度很慢这就是为什么如果您是初创公司或周末/黑客松项目则应使用Ruby 使用RailsPythonNode JS或其他任何可以让您快速原型化保存和刷新轻松进行迭代的东西。 好吧那根本不是真的而且我甚至都不知道它来自哪里。 可能是因为流程繁重的大公司使用Java因此制作Java应用程序会花费更多时间。 而且“保存并刷新”对于初学者来说可能令人望而生畏但是使用Java针对Web编程了一段时间的任何人都必须知道一种自动化方法否则他是n00b对吗。 我已经总结了可能的方法 并且大多数方法都可以。 这里的另一个示例也可以用作上述要点的示例–我做了这个项目用于验证周末 1天之内网站的安全密码存储以解决晚上的问题。 包括安全性研究。 Spring-MVCJSP模板MongoDB。 再次-快速简便。 如果没有IDE 您将无法在Java中执行任何操作 -当然可以您可以使用notepad vim和emacs。 您将只缺少重构保存时编译调用层次结构。 就像使用PHP或Python或javascript进行编程一样。 关于IDE与编辑器的争论很长但是您可以在没有IDE的情况下使用Java。 这样做没有任何意义因为从IDE获得的收益远远超过从文本编辑器命令行工具获得的收益。 您可能会争辩说因为我有丰富的经验所以我能够快速编写精美而简单的Java应用程序我确切地知道要使用不使用哪些工具而且我是一些常识性的稀有开发人员。 虽然我会为此受宠若惊但我与优秀的Ruby开发人员或Python专家没有什么不同。 只是Java太普及了以至于没有好的开发人员和工具。 如果有那么多人使用其他语言那么可能会生成相同数量的糟糕代码。 即使使用更少PHP也已经领先。 我是最后一个不嘲笑Java的人它当然不是灵丹妙药但是如果人们因传闻证据或以前的不良经历而对误解的理解减少了我会更高兴la“从我之前的公司开始我就讨厌Java因为该项目非常肿”。 不仅是因为我不喜欢别人有偏见而且因为您可能会以一种不起作用的语言开始下一个项目只是因为您听说过“ Java不好”。 翻译自: https://www.javacodegeeks.com/2014/04/common-misconceptions-about-java.html
http://www.yutouwan.com/news/244049/

相关文章:

  • 外国酷炫网站郑州公司企业网站建设
  • wordpress子目录网站高端网站制作系统
  • 网站建设佰首选金手指二六公章在线印章制作生成免费
  • 网站推广策划评估工具7frontpage官方下载
  • 如何重视企业网站的建设android wap网站
  • 写作网站投稿哪个好江西新农村建设权威网站
  • 免费网站app代码wordpress seo h1标签
  • Wordpress热门评论插件seo排名优化方法
  • 软件开发 网站开发哪个难红铃铛网站建设
  • php模板网站wordpress 转发
  • asp网站后台上传不了图片关键词收录
  • 企业网站可以自己做吗电影网站推广
  • 上海住房和城乡建设网站网站推广app软件
  • 站内搜索引擎给娃娃做衣服卖的网站
  • 建站公司咨询潍坊网站建设公司慕枫
  • 专注于响应式网站开发seo什么意思简单来说
  • 中国纳溪门户网站建设项目环境影响如何建设音乐网站
  • 怎样建网站才艺多网站建设
  • 网站搭建的流程及费用是多少?国内网站制作特点
  • 广州哪里做公司网站号4成都网站建设
  • 苏州公司网站建设电话网站怎么做快推广方案
  • 下载网站后怎么做的做钓鱼网站软件
  • 搭建网站的主要风险页面设计成上下两栏
  • 用自己主机做网站山东网站制作
  • 漂流瓶做任务网站软件商店app
  • 做网站加模块做的好的装修公司网站
  • 深圳品牌网站建设公司排名百度seo
  • 网站开发需要干什么美客多电商平台入驻链接
  • 新网站百度多久收录软件高端开发
  • 织梦57网站的友情链接怎么做印象笔记同步wordpress